About Gordon Whitney Weir
Gordon Whitney Weir is a scholar working on Geochemistry and Petrology, Anthropology and Geophysics, having authored 9 papers that have together received 347 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Archaeology and Natural History (3 papers), Botany, Ecology, and Taxonomy Studies (3 papers) and Geological Modeling and Analysis (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Earth-Surface Processes (230 citations), Paleontology (103 citations) and Atmospheric Science (180 citations). Gordon Whitney Weir has collaborated with scholars based in United States. Frequent co-authors include Edwin D. McKee, John Pojeta, Warren Peterson, L. Sue Beard and G. E. Ulrich. Their work appears in journals such as Geological Society of America Bulletin, USGS professional paper and Antarctica A Keystone in a Changing World.
